2. A tailor-made English copywriting training uses your real work
Generic writing tips only go so far. At WordWorx, every English copywriting training for teams is tailored to your organisation and your daily tasks.
Before the training, you send us examples of your communication and marketing deliverables. For example:
- Web pages
- Brochures or product sheets
- Email campaigns or newsletters
- Social media posts
- Internal news items or leadership messages
We analyse these materials and design an English copywriting training programme around them. During the session, we work directly with your own texts. We improve real headlines, sharpen calls to action, and adjust tone of voice so it fits your brand.
You can choose online or in-person sessions, or a mix of both. The content, pace and exercises are adjusted to your team’s level and needs. Our course isn’t a ‘copy and paste’ one. Only focused, practical learning that your people can use the next day.
3. English copywriting training in an AI world
The world of writing and content is changing fast. Many teams already use AI tools to draft blog posts, product copy, emails or social media content. This can save time, but it also brings new questions about what this means for the quality of our communication and how we can keep a strong brand voice.
In our tailor-made English copywriting training, we do not ignore AI. We include AI copywriting as part of the training (depending also on your company’s policy regarding AI use). We look at how to prompt AI tools properly, how to edit AI drafts, and where human judgment is essential.
Most of all, we place people at the heart of writing. Your readers are human. Your brand is human. Your team is human. The training helps your people to use AI in a smart way, while still writing copy that feels honest, clear and human-centred.
